Remy Ling
Fulbright All-Disciplines Postgraduate Award - Tulane University
Remy holds a first-class LLB in Law with Business from the University of Exeter and recently completed the Bar Practice Course. During her Fulbright studies, Remy will pursue an LLM in Maritime and Admiralty Law at Tulane University. Her interest in this field developed while undertaking legal work experience, where she observed how geopolitics affect international business transactions and pose complex legal challenges. Remy has a particular interest in alternative dispute resolution and has undertaken further training in this area to become an IMI qualified mediator and a member of the Chartered Institute of Arbitrators. Through her LLM studies, Remy hopes to deepen her understanding of the role of international arbitration in resolving maritime disputes, and the broader relationship between international commerce and the law. Upon completion of her Fulbright studies, Remy will return to the UK to continue her training as a barrister through a specialist commercial and chancery pupillage.
